What adjustments when you retrofit versus develop new
On a brand-new build, the illustrations usually give us a clean opening, proper headroom, and a power stub at the driver's side. Equipment, bracing, and the door system can be made as a bundle. Timelines make sense, the piece is true, and the door is mounted in turn with various other professions. The control is still crucial, but you have room to maximize without peeling off back layers of history.
Retrofits are where experience settles. Existing lintels may be out of degree by three quarters of an inch. Jambs that used to hold a timber door are too soft for a rolling steel barrel. Clearance is limited since someone years ago tucked ductwork a little also near the opening. We frequently adjust with low-headroom track sets, alternative installing angles, and creative supporting that appreciates architectural capacity. You likewise need a prepare for traffic. Shutting down a dock door for even half a day can snarl the whole operation. That is why a working retrofit commonly indicates pre-assembling sections, presenting equipment, and scheduling crane time throughout low-volume hours.
A short example from a freezer retrofit: a customer needed a high-speed fabric door on a 12 by 14 opening, yet the evaporators left just 14 inches of clearance. By revolving the barrel to the outside side, switching over to a side-mounted electric motor, and connecting guard posts into the slab with epoxy anchors, we fit the door, protected the clear opening, and cut seepage sufficient to minimize defrost cycles. None of that was on the original plan set. Field eyes made it work.

Sectional steel doors are the workhorse for storage facilities, vehicle stores, and light production. Panels secure well, R-values from approximately 12 to 26 are possible with foamed-in-place insulation, and components are widely readily available. They require headroom for track, typically 12 to 24 inches, more for high-lift or full vertical applications. Speeds are moderate, around 8 to 12 inches per second with a jackshaft or cart driver, yet they are silent and service-friendly.
Rolling steel service doors shine where longevity and security are leading priorities. They roll right into a small coil above the opening, excellent for limited clearance. Slats can be galvanized, stainless, or light weight aluminum, with vision or air circulation choices. Driver rates often tend to be 8 to 10 inches per 2nd, however high performance designs run quicker. Moving grilles secure store fronts and vehicle parking structures while permitting ventilation.
High-speed textile or rubber doors are the website traffic superheroes. Believe 40 to 100 inches per second, with soft-bottom sides and impact-reset designs that zip back into the guides after a forklift kiss. They are ideal for food and drink, cold store, and high cycle logistics. They do not shield like a protected sectional, however their speed reduces air exchange, which often matters more in conditioned environments.
Aluminum full-view doors provide showrooms and breweries natural light and a crisp appearance. They are sectional in structure so you require track area, and they couple perfectly with variable-speed drivers for smooth motion. Not the highest possible R-value, but they offer visibility and branding value.
Specialty doors load specific niches: fire-rated moving doors and counter shutters that drop under alarm system, hurricane-rated doors for seaside zones, corrosion-resistant bundles for washdown or chemical direct exposure. If your specification checks out NFPA 80 or Miami-Dade, this is the lane.
Matching the door to the obligation cycle and environment
We begin with 3 numbers: door size, everyday cycles, and inside conditions. A 10 by 10 door that opens 200 times a day demands various hardware than a 14 by 16 door that relocates only in the early morning and afternoon. Spring choice on a sectional door could jump from 20,000 to 50,000 cycle torsion collections. For high-speed devices, the transmission and brake plan should be sized for warmth dissipation during peak shifts. When a food mill tells us they wash down with 180 degree water and caustic foam, we choose stainless bolts, covered bearings, and non-hollow bottom bars. For coastal or plant food applications, we lean on hot-dip galvanized or light weight aluminum parts, plus powder coat over zinc for extra protection.
Insulation and air leakage matter for more than comfort. Under IECC demands, many conditioned areas need doors with specified U-factors or tested air seepage prices. An insulated sectional with thermal breaks and high-performance boundary seals can drop infiltration much more than a fundamental sheet door. In a fridge freezer, rate beats raw R-value, since every 2nd the door is open dumps costly cold. We frequently pair a high-speed fabric indoor door with an insulated sectional or rolling steel outside door, developing an air lock that balances effectiveness and security.
Power, controls, and safety and security that teams trust
Operator option is a huge component of Industrial Garage Door Service preparation. For light obligation, a single-phase 120 or 240 volt jackshaft does fine. Hefty doors, high cycle usage, and many moving steel systems do much better with 3-phase power at 208, 230, or 460 volts. Variable regularity drives include soft begin and stop, reduce stress on the door, and minimize noise. You will certainly really feel the difference on a high high-lift where panel rattle disappears and the driver moves to a stop.
Safety is not optional. UL 325 conformity requires monitored safety and security gadgets. That means picture eyes or a monitored sensing edge tied into the operator, not simply a heritage non-monitored side. On high-speed doors, we like light drapes that cover the lower 6 feet of the opening because they capture greater than a solitary light beam. For fire-rated rolling doors, release devices should attach to the alarm system and examination yearly. We document decrease examinations and maintain those documents on documents so your AHJ is happy.
Access control has actually grown. Keypads, distance cards, cordless remotes, interlocks with dock levelers, and building administration system tie-ins are regular. With smart controllers, you can track cycle counts, timetable auto-close times, or get a sharp if a door stops working to secure. That is especially valuable in cooled areas and clean areas where a door exposed even five mins develops waste.
Framing, supporting, and the physics behind a peaceful, true door
A door that runs real beginnings with strong mounting surfaces. On retrofits, we occasionally include steel tube structures to develop plumb, square jambs when masonry has wandered. For rolling steel doors, appropriate add-on of wall surface angles and barrel support layers protects against racking that chew out guides. On sectionals, we choose the best track kind: conventional lift to clear a low mezzanine, high-lift to follow an increasing ceiling, or full vertical to keep vehicles clear. Track gauge and angle bracing should match the door weight and usage. A 24 gauge, 10 foot door in a light car bay does not require the same muscular tissue as a 14 by 16 wind-rated door on a distribution center.
Wind is an additional peaceful offender. In seaside or open pasture environments, layout stress rise. We specify wind lots scores to match neighborhood codes, sometimes 130 to 170 miles per hour equivalent stress. That indicates much heavier struts, stiffer tracks, beefier bolts, and sometimes smaller panel periods. If you have actually ever before seen an improperly supported door pant in a storm, you recognize why this matters.
How the setup day actually unfolds
A tidy install is choreography. For a sectional replacement, we protect the opening, shut out the old driver, launch and bar the springtimes, then take apart the panels and track. We prepare the jambs, established brand-new brackets, hang track plumb and level, and stack panels with proper hinge positioning. Springs get wound with a torque graph and range reading that verifies risk-free equilibrium. We set wires, test travel, and tune the driver restrictions. Good staffs cycle the door repeatedly at the end to catch massages or cable put prior to they leave.
Rolling steel sets up vary. We lift the barrel and curtain to their installing angles, settle the braces, and established the shaft with proper endplay. Guides get plumbed and shimmed. When the curtain hangs and locks right into the guides, we attach the operator, established limit cameras or electronic limits, and run examination cycles under lots. On a high-speed door, we settle the side columns, set stress on the drape, align the refeed system, and program rate and stopping profiles.
Downtime is constantly the wildcard. At FireKing we usually present new equipment on-site a day early, so all openings are pierced and anchors set before the shutdown home window starts. On busy docks, we turn setups so you never ever lose greater than one bay at a time.

Retrofit case snapshots that reveal the range
A grocery warehouse in a windy corridor needed 3 12 by 14 moving steel doors upgraded to stand up to greater pressures. The initial set up utilized light guide angles that bent. We exchanged to much heavier guides, re-anchored right into the CMU on a tighter pattern with Hilti adhesive supports, and replaced the curtains with ranked slats. After the upgrade, driver tons dropped, door persuade disappeared, and the upkeep team reported less nuisance limit trips.
A vehicle body shop coped with a double-entry arrangement, narrow apron, and tight clearance. We changed 2 tiny doors with one 20 by 10 full-view aluminum sectional utilizing a high-lift track to clear lights and ductwork. A 3 HP VFD operator maintained the glass panels moving at a constant 12 inches per secondly. The store got a full-size bay, brighter interior light, and lowered door whiplash throughout winter season gusts.
When repair service is smarter than substitute, and where the line flips
Commercial garage door fixing is not a consolation prize. Lots of issues are targeted and fixable: snapped torsion springs, frayed cable televisions, curved tracks, fried contactors, worn bearings, or a slat harmed by a pallet. A same-day swap of springs or a rebuilt gearbox can restore feature with marginal cost.
Replacement makes sense when the opening has actually transformed use, when panels or drapes are worn down across their span, or when the door lacks required security or wind features. If an insulated sectional has flaked panels across a number of sections, patching ends up being a money pit. When operators lack monitored security inputs and spare parts are long gone, upgrades are commonly necessary. We check out lifecycle mathematics. If a door sets you back 12,000 dollars to change and your repair estimates over 3 years struck 7,000 to 9,000 bucks with recurring downtime, you will likely be happier with brand-new equipment, a fresh warranty, and reduced disruptions.

Lead times, spending plans, and what drives set you back up or down
Timelines vary with market problems. Criterion sectional doors can show up in 2 to 6 weeks. Rolling steel with custom finishes or special slat kinds could run 6 to 10 weeks. High-speed textile doors land in the 3 to 8 week band, quicker for common sizes, slower for washdown or freezer bundles. Fire-rated settings up in some cases take much longer as a result of listing requirements.
Cost drivers are straightforward. Dimension is the largest lever, in addition to wind rating, surface, and insulation. Devices like light curtains, traffic lights, or interlocks add small expense however huge worth. Electrical runs include expense if the panel is far from the opening. Retrofits can require structural tube frames or lintel reinforcement that pushes budgets higher. On the flip side, reliable staging and a door spec that matches real usage can save thousands in time. A door that cycles 40 percent quicker, opens up completely clear for forklifts, and seals dependably repays with productivity and power savings.
For harsh order-of-magnitude planning, a mid-size shielded sectional with a smart jackshaft operator may land in the 5,000 to 12,000 buck array mounted, while a moving steel service door with wind ranking and 3-phase operator can rest in between 8,000 and 18,000 bucks. High-speed doors have a tendency to range 10,000 to 25,000 dollars depending on size and choices. These are broad bands, not quotes. Field problems and options set real number.
Service is the other fifty percent of installation
A good Commercial Garage Door Service plan begins on the first day. We record spring turns, cable television drum settings, operator criteria, and sensor types. Cycle counters give us actual data to arrange maintenance. Common solution intervals are every 6 months for high-use doors, annually for low-use. We lube joints and rollers where appropriate, inspect spring stress and shaft set screws, test all safety and security gadgets, and validate the door balances dead neutral in mid travel. On rolling steel, we inspect slat involvement, endlocks, hood supports, and operator chain tension. For high-speed doors, we clean up image eyes and drapes, validate refeed systems, and test emergency egress or breakaway functions.
Commercial garage door repair service must be predictable. Keep common components on the shelf: torsion springs for well-known sizes, picture eyes, edges, operator contactors, limitation switches, and a few extra panels or slats if lead times are recognized to extend. Rapid action is component planning, component inventory.
Special environments that alter the rules
In food processing, washdown scores and non-corrosive products are not flexible. Secured bearings, stainless shafts, and polymer overviews maintain cleansing chemicals from grinding your door to dust. In cold store, doors require heated guides and lower bars, or anti-frost sides, and the control logic take advantage of much shorter close hold-ups to restrict infiltration. For hazardous areas, driver elements might require Course I Div 2 rated rooms, and image eyes need to be selected for the atmosphere. For clean rooms, soft seals and reduced particle products are vital, and operators require constant velocity to prevent panel shake that drops dust.
Hospitals and laboratories sometimes ask for quiet operators and light curtains that allow cart or cart passage without touching a switch. Retail and parking structures value remote monitoring for after-hours alarm systems and fast reset after influences. We combine the option to the pressure point that matters most.
Integration with dock tools and building systems
A door that coordinates with dock levelers and automobile restrictions stops a surprising number of crashes. We commonly wire the sequence so the dock leveler can not release till the restraint verifies a secured trailer, and the door will closed up until both are pleased. Add traffic signal on both sides of the opening and you reduce miscommunication in between motorists and dock staff. For cold anchors, an interlock that keeps the door closed while the leveler is coming down minimizes airflow when it matters most. Structure management linkups can log open times per door and determine problem bays that chew power or sluggish operations.
The retrofit toolkit FireKing teams depend on
Real success commonly boils down to information. Shim kits that do not compress, appropriate stonework bolts for CMU cells, and torque-verified wedge supports hold the setup stable. Laser levels conserve time chasing placements. Cable reels and protected channels prevent future grabs from forklifts. Guards and bollards should be part of the package, not a second thought, due to the fact that every bay with forklift web traffic will ultimately deal with a near miss.
When steel is out of square, we frame a new real opening inside the old, then install the door to the framework. It sets you back a bit even more in advance and saves years of grief. When clearance is too tight for a common sectional, we think about low-headroom track with dual spring assemblies and a jackshaft operator located off sideways, or we transform lanes to a moving steel with a portable coil. If a lintel bends under tons, we add a spreader plate or brand-new structural steel above the opening so the weight is brought effectively. These adjustments are not fancy, but they make the difference between a door that sings and a door that grinds.
